如何从MySQL绿色版迁移到MySQL官方版本?

MySQL绿色版是一个不需要安装的MySQL版本,可以直接解压后使用。要从MySQL到MySQL进行数据传输,可以使用mysqldump工具导出数据,然后使用mysql命令将数据导入到另一个MySQL数据库中。

Mysql Windows 绿色版安装指南

如何从MySQL绿色版迁移到MySQL官方版本?

Mysql是一个广泛使用的开源关系型数据库管理系统,其Windows绿色版提供了一个无需安装的轻便式数据库服务器,下面将详细介绍如何下载、初始化并配置Mysql绿色版。

1.下载与解压

下载:首先需要从Mysql的官方网站下载Windows绿色版,可以选择所需的版本,例如MySQL Community Server 8.0.34。

解压:下载完成后,得到一个zip格式的压缩包,将其解压到任意目录(推荐使用英文路径),解压后,你将看到包含多个子文件夹和文件的mysql目录。

2.初始化服务器数据

进入目录:通过cmd进入之前解压得到的mysql目录中的bin文件夹。

创建data文件夹:在mysql服务器目录下创建一个名为“data”的空文件夹,这个文件夹将用来存储数据库的数据信息。

编辑my.ini文件:由于从5.7.18版本开始,MySQL不再提供mydefault.ini文件,所以需要手动创建一个名为my.ini的文件并进行配置。

3.配置my.ini文件

创建与编辑:在mysql目录下创建my.ini文件,并通过文本编辑器打开编辑,文件中需要指定basedir(MySQL所在目录)和datadir(data目录路径)等重要参数,确保这些路径与实际存放位置一致。

具体配置内容:配置文件中的内容可能根据不同版本的MySQL有所不同,但主要涉及数据库服务器的运行参数设置,如端口号、默认字符集等。

4.启动MySQL服务

打开命令提示符:在“开始”菜单中搜索“cmd”或“命令提示符”,右键以管理员身份运行。

定位至MySQL目录:使用cd命令切换到你的MySQL服务器的bin目录,cd C:mysql8.0.34winx64bin,请根据实际情况替换为你自己的路径。

注册MySQL服务:在命令行中输入以下命令来注册MySQL服务:

“`bash

mysqld install

“`

启动MySQL服务:输入以下命令来启动MySQL服务:

“`bash

net start mysql

“`

设置root密码:首次运行时,root用户没有密码,需要通过以下命令设置密码:

“`bash

mysqladmin u root p password

“`

当提示输入密码时,由于当前没有设置密码,直接回车即可,然后按照提示输入新的密码。

5.测试连接

使用MySQL客户端:下载并安装MySQL Workbench或其他MySQL客户端软件。

建立连接:打开MySQL客户端,新建一个连接到本地MySQL服务器,使用刚才设置的root用户名和密码进行测试。

6.常见问题解决

端口占用问题:如果在启动时遇到“端口3306已经被占用”的错误,可以考虑更换MySQL的端口或关闭占用该端口的其他应用程序。

编码问题:确保在my.ini文件中设置了正确的字符集,如defaultcharacterset=utf8,避免出现乱码问题。

权限问题:以管理员身份运行cmd,确保cmd有足够权限执行mysqld的相关操作。

7.相关FAQs

Q1: 如何更新MySQL绿色版?

A1: 更新MySQL绿色版时,首先从官网下载最新版本的压缩包,然后停止当前的MySQL服务,用新解压的文件夹替换旧的版本文件夹,最后重新启动MySQL服务即可。

Q2: 是否可以在不同项目使用不同版本的MySQL绿色版?

A2: 是的,可以在不同项目中使用不同版本的MySQL绿色版,只需为每个项目维护独立的MySQL服务器目录,并在各自的配置文件中指定不同的数据存储路径和端口号,从而避免冲突。

通过上述步骤,您可以在Windows环境下成功安装并运行MySQL绿色版,无需繁琐的安装过程,即可快速搭建起数据库环境,无论是日常学习还是项目开发,绿色版MySQL都是一个不错的选择。

原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/1044070.html

(0)
未希的头像未希新媒体运营
上一篇 2024-09-16 02:33
下一篇 2024-09-16 02:35

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注

云产品限时秒杀。精选云产品高防服务器,20M大带宽限量抢购  >>点击进入